Monthly Home Fragrance Report
A monthly report tracking the UK's most popular home fragrance scents using Google search behaviour, AI search trends, Nuscents sales data and wider market signals.
Published 2nd March 2025
January 2025 Edition

January 2025 Findings
January was dominated by clean, cosy and comfort-led home fragrance. Laundry scents performed especially strongly, with Fresh Linen, Clean Cotton and Spring Awakening all appearing in the Top 20.
Fresh Linen, Clean Cotton and White Dove all benefited from January’s “fresh start” behaviour, where shoppers searched for cleaner, brighter home fragrance after Christmas.
Vanilla, Black Cherry, Fireside and Cinnamon remained strong, showing that warm, indulgent fragrances still carried demand through the colder part of the year.
Alien, La Vie Est Belle, Dark Opium and Baccarat Rouge 540 all ranked inside the Top 20, suggesting continued demand for luxury-style fragrance profiles in home fragrance.
Rose, Jasmine & Patchouli, Pink Sands and Spring Awakening climbed as shoppers began moving from heavy festive scents towards fresher and more uplifting profiles.

Methodology
Each scent is given an index score out of 100. The score combines search demand, AI search interest, Nuscents sales data, monthly movement and wider market signals. The result is a balanced view of what the UK appears to be interested in, not just what sold most in one shop.
